This small change can help with learning to code
When I was learning to code, I didn't have ChatGPT or any type of artificial intelligence to help. I had to use documentation as well as forum groups and communities in order to help me with my answers. I think if I were to have learned it today fresh, I would definitely be utilizing AI in this way. https://youtube.com/shorts/fGzBZ4kda6E?si=a014z2IUtUCQhzSx?views And in the video, I kind of explain what's going on. Basically, if you are learning something about loops and Python, then I would then turn to ChatGPT and ask the question: Hey, I am learning about loops and Python. Can you give me three mini challenges that could help me solidify what I just learned? Do not give me the solution. I just only need the prompt. And then, if you need a little bit more help, then what I would ask ChatGPT to do is add some pseudocode to help me along the way. And it's going to give you some reminders to help jog your memory on what should be next in order for you to complete the challenge.
